India Seeks Series Wrap Up at Rohit’s Favourite Hunting Ground

India will look to wrap up the ODI series against Sri Lanka when they take the field for the 2nd ODI at the Eden Gardens in Kolkata on January 12. Sri Lanka, on the other hand, will be desperately hoping to not repeat the mistakes from the 1st ODI and secure a win to stay alive in the series. India defeated Sri Lanka in the 1st ODI by 67 runs in conditions that were heavily favoring the batsmen. 

Eden Gardens: Rohit’s Favourite Hunting Venue

There is certainly some connection between Eden Gardens and Rohit Sharma as per the batter’s past performance records. Here are some stats of the Indian captain Rohit Sharma that points towards the love affair between him and the iconic venue – 

  • Rohit made his test debut at Eden Gardens in 2013 against the West Indies and scored a century in his debut test
  • Rohit’s highest ODI score also came at the same venue and incidentally against the same opponents (264 in 2014)
  • The “Hitman” also has an IPL century against the Kolkata Knight Riders at Eden Gardens
  • In 8 games the Indian captain has plates so far in this venue, he has aggregated 569 runs at an average of 71.12

All these stats offer a glimpse of hope for the Indian and Rohit Sharma fans that he will return to form with his 30th ODI century against Sri Lanka at his favorite hunting ground.

India vs Sri Lanka 2nd ODI Expected Playing Conditions

The Eden Garden pitch has offered a lot to the batsmen in the past couple of years. Also, there will be heavy dew during the evening that will have a lot of impact on the bowlers’ bowling second at this venue. Captains winning the toss have always preferred chasing due to the smaller ground dimensions and external factors. Expect nothing different in India vs Sri Lanka 2nd ODI.
